A surge of newcomers is questioning the best time to enter the volatile crypto market, specifically regarding Bitcoin (BTC), as many express uncertainty amid a market decline. With various strategies on the table, potential investors are keen to chart a path forward.

Market Sentiment

Many investors took to forums to share their insights about buying Bitcoin during the recent downturn. The consensus appears to lean toward strategy over timing.

"It is always, always, always a good time to buy BTC. That's lesson #1 in crypto investing," one voice noted, capturing the optimism in the community.

Three Main Investing Strategies

  1. Dollar-Cost Averaging (DCA): Many commentators suggest employing DCA, which involves investing fixed amounts regularly, irrespective of Bitcoin's price fluctuations. This tactic helps mitigate stress around timing investments.

  2. Long-Term Vision: A number of participants emphasized that BTC is a solid long-term investment. As one contributor pointed out, "Buying a well-established asset like BTC can make sense as a cornerstone, especially if you're thinking long-term."

  3. Stay Informed: Several voices advised new investors to educate themselves, suggesting to monitor price movements and market trends to make more informed decisions.
